The per-mile deltas that decide it

Two numbers drive almost everything: energy cost per mile and maintenance cost per mile. Energy is price divided by efficiency — electricity ÷ mi/kWh for the EV, fuel ÷ MPG for combustion. At typical 2026 commercial rates an electric van runs around $0.06 a mile on energy against roughly $0.17 for gas or diesel.

Maintenance widens the gap. The DOE Alternative Fuels Data Center benchmarks scheduled EV maintenance about 40% below a combustion vehicle — no oil changes, fewer moving parts, and regenerative braking that spares the pads. Multiply both deltas by your annual miles and you get the yearly operating savings that repay the EV's higher sticker price.

Charger install is the swing factor

The purchase-price gap is visible; the charging install is the cost fleets underestimate. Depot chargers, electrical panel upgrades, and utility service work are a one-time capital outlay that this tool amortizes across every vehicle — a $60,000 install over ten vans adds $6,000 to each EV's effective upfront cost.

That single line item often moves breakeven by a year or more, which is why the calculator compares the case with and without it. Utility make-ready programs and charger rebates, where available, blunt the impact — model them in the incentive field.

Incentives, resale, and the 45W sunset

The federal 45W commercial clean-vehicle credit — worth up to $7,500 for lighter vehicles and $40,000 for heavy ones — ended in 2025. Fleet cases built on it no longer apply, but many states and utilities still offer purchase or infrastructure incentives; enter any per-vehicle amount to see how much it pulls breakeven forward.

Resale is the other wildcard. This tool recovers a share of each vehicle's price at the end of your horizon, applied evenly to both drivetrains. EV residuals were historically softer, but improving battery-longevity data is closing the gap — if you expect a different outcome, adjust the resale percentage and watch the fleet TCO shift.
